Opinion: Will Canon EOS Film Cameras Ever be Classic?

Any list of classic cameras would need to include the first generation EOS film SLR cameras, the 650, 620 and 630 (sold as the 600 in Europe). They set standards in performance and design that continue in Canon’s digital cameras.
